How Our Ceiling Water Damage Repair Process Works
When you call our team for ceiling water damage repair, you can rest assured that we’ll take care of the entire process from start to finish. Our rapid response times ensure that we’re at your property within 60 minutes where we’ll conduct a thorough assessment of the damage and develop a customized repair plan tailored to your specific needs.
Step 1: Assessment and Inspection
Our team will carefully inspect your ceiling and surrounding areas to identify the source of the water damage and assess the extent of the damage. We’ll use state-of-the-art equipment to detect hidden water damage and identify any potential hazards.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Drying
Next, we’ll use industrial-grade equipment to extract as much water as possible from your ceiling and surrounding areas. This is followed by a thorough drying process, which helps to prevent further damage and reduce the risk of mold growth.
Step 3: Damage Repair and Restoration
Once the area is dry, our team will begin the process of repairing and restoring your ceiling and surrounding areas. This may involve patching damaged drywall, replacing damaged flooring, or repairing any other affected areas.
Step 4: Final Inspection and Cleaning
Finally, we’ll conduct a thorough final inspection to ensure that the repair is complete and the area is safe and secure. We’ll also clean and disinfect the area to prevent the growth of mold and mildew.

Warning Signs You Need Ceiling Water Damage Repair
Catching water damage early on can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ent serious health risks. But how do you know if you have a problem on your hands? Here are 5 common war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a musty or mildewy smell coming from your ceiling or surrounding areas, it’s a clear sign that water damage has occurred. Don’t ignore it, call our team today to schedule a consultation and get the problem resolved.
Water Stains or Discoloration
Water stains or discoloration on your ceiling can be a sign of water damage or leaks in your roof or pipes. Don’t delay call our team to schedule a consultation and get the problem fixed before it’s too late.
Water Droplets or Leaks
Water droplets or leaks on your ceiling or in your walls can be a sign of hidden water damage or leaks in your roof or pipes. Don’t wait call our team to schedule a consultation and get the problem resolved.
Warped or Buckled Drywall
Warped or buckled drywall can be a sign of water damage or moisture buildup in your ceiling or surrounding areas. Don’t ignore it call our team to schedule a consultation and get the problem fixed.
Peeling or Cracking Paint
Peeling or cracking paint on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of water damage or moisture buildup in your ceiling or surrounding areas. Don’t delay call our team to schedule a consultation and get the problem resolved.

Ceiling Water Damage Repair Cost in Selma, CA
The cost of ceiling water damage repair can vary widely depending on the severity and extent of the damage, as well as local conditions in Selma, CA. As a general rule, the sooner you act the less expensive the repair will be. Our team is happy to provide a free estimate for your specific situation, just call us today to schedule a consultation!
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, amount of water damage, and local labor costs |
| Drywall repair and replacement |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of drywall, and local labor costs |
| Painting and finishing |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of paint, and local labor costs |
| Mold remediation and removal |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of mold, and local labor costs |
| Structural repair and restoration |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of structural damage, and local labor costs |
| Final inspection and cleaning | $500 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and local labor costs |
